WebCompanies House and HMRC impose different filing deadlines for annual accounts. They are as follows: first accounts for Companies House – 21 months after the date of company formation. subsequent accounts for Companies House – 9 months after the end of your company’s financial year. WebFeb 25, 2024 · A full set of statutory accounts would include: A profit and loss account. A balance sheet (signed by a director) A directors’ report. An auditors’ report (unless the company qualifies for an exemption) Notes to the accounts. However, not all companies need to submit this complete suite of information.
